I would like to know if it is possible to determine how tables are related to each other (foreign ley relationship) using some pre built ABAP program if it already exists. Else, can you please tell me how we can do this using any other method?

Hi,
Follow this process. You can easily discover the relationships among tables.
1. Use SQVI transaction,
2. Create a View
3. Enter title,
4. Choose the Data source as Table Join
5. Now use Insert table option.
6. And insert the tables which you want. It will propose the relation between them.Thanks

go to SE11 and give some tbale name and dispaly then agagin click graphic button or press
controlshiftF11
you can see the realtion between tables with your enterd table...

just go to se11, and display the contents of table,
In the Application tool bar there is a button Where-used-list with icon of 3 arrows, click on that button then a POP-Up will come select the check-box of DB tabel and uncheck all other checkbox...
it will give the list,, no report available for that functionallity this can be achieved with se11 only....
